Google se compromete a impulsar la igualdad racial para las comunidades afrodescendientes. Obtén información al respecto.

Tipos y funciones de nodos

Organiza tus páginas con colecciones Guarda y categoriza el contenido según tus preferencias.

Ver el código fuente en GitHub

Funciones de reenvío

Funciones del nodo OT

En una red Thread, los nodos se dividen en dos roles de reenvío:

Router

Un router es un nodo que tiene las siguientes características:

  • Reenvía paquetes para dispositivos de red.
  • Proporciona servicios de asignación seguros para los dispositivos que intentan conectarse a la red.
  • mantiene habilitado el transceptor en todo momento

Dispositivo final

Un dispositivo final (ED) es un nodo que tiene las siguientes características:

  • se comunica principalmente con un solo router
  • No reenvía paquetes para otros dispositivos de red.
  • puede inhabilitar su transceptor para reducir la energía

Tipos de dispositivos

Además, los nodos comprenden varios tipos.

Taxonomía de dispositivos de OT

Dispositivo de conversación completa

Un dispositivo de subproceso completo (FTD) siempre tiene su radio activada, se suscribe a la dirección de multidifusión de todos los routers y mantiene las asignaciones de direcciones IPv6. Existen tres tipos de FTD:

  • Router
  • Dispositivo final apto (REED) del router: Se puede pasar a un router.
  • Dispositivo de extremo completo (FED): no se puede ascender a un router.

Una FTD puede funcionar como router (superior) o dispositivo final (secundario).

Dispositivo Thread mínimo

Un dispositivo Thread mínimo no se suscribe a la dirección multidifusión de todos los routers y reenvía todos los mensajes a su superior. Existen dos tipos de MTD:

  • Dispositivo final mínimo (MED): El transmisor siempre está activado, no necesita consultar los mensajes de su superior
  • Dispositivo final soñoliento (SED): Por lo general, se inhabilita y, en ocasiones, se activa para consultar los mensajes de su elemento superior.

Un MTD solo puede funcionar como un Dispositivo Final (secundario).

Cómo actualizar y cambiar a una versión inferior

Cuando un REED es el único nodo al alcance de un nuevo dispositivo final que desea unirse a la red de Thread, puede actualizarse y operar como un router:

Dispositivo de finalización del OT al router

En cambio, cuando un router no tiene elementos secundarios, puede cambiar a una versión inferior y operar como un dispositivo final:

Router de OT al dispositivo de destino

Otras funciones y tipos

Líder de la conversación

Líder de OT y router de borde

El líder de Thread es un router responsable de administrar el conjunto de routers en una red de Thread. Se selecciona de forma dinámica para la tolerancia a errores, y agrega y distribuye información de configuración en toda la red.

Router de borde

Un router de borde es un dispositivo que puede reenviar información entre una red Thread y una que no sea de Thread (por ejemplo, Wi-Fi). También configura una red Thread para conectividad externa.

Cualquier dispositivo puede funcionar como un router de borde.

Particiones

Particiones de OT

Una red Thread puede estar compuesta por particiones. Esto sucede cuando un grupo de dispositivos Thread no puede comunicarse con otro grupo de dispositivos Thread. Cada partición funciona de forma lógica como una red Thread distinta con su propio líder, asignaciones de ID de router y datos de red, mientras conserva las mismas credenciales de seguridad para todos los dispositivos en todas las particiones.

Las particiones de una red Thread no tienen conectividad inalámbrica entre sí y, si las particiones recuperan la conectividad, se fusionan automáticamente en una sola partición.

Ten en cuenta que, en este manual, el uso de "Red de Thread" supone una sola partición. Cuando sea necesario, los conceptos y ejemplos clave se aclaran con el término "partición". Más adelante en esta guía, se explican las particiones.

Límites de dispositivos

Hay un límite para la cantidad de tipos de dispositivos que admite una sola red Thread.

Rol Límite
Líder 1
Router 32
Dispositivo final 511 por router

Thread intenta mantener la cantidad de routers entre 16 y 23. Si se adjunta un REED como dispositivo final y la cantidad de routers de la red es inferior a 16, se promueve automáticamente a un router.

Resumen

Qué aprendió:

  • Un dispositivo Thread puede ser un router (superior) o un dispositivo final (secundario).
  • Un dispositivo Thread es un dispositivo de subproceso completo (mantiene asignaciones de direcciones IPv6) o un dispositivo de subproceso mínimo (reenvía todos los mensajes a su elemento superior).
  • Un dispositivo final apto para routers puede ascenderse a un router y viceversa.
  • Todas las particiones de red de Thread tienen un líder para administrar los routers
  • Se usa un router de borde para conectar redes de Thread y que no sean de Thread
  • Una red Thread puede estar compuesta por múltiples particiones.

Comprueba tus conocimientos

Un dispositivo de red Thread puede cumplir con una de dos funciones de reenvío. ¿Cuáles son?
Nodo secundario.
Incorrecto.
Router
Correcto.
Dispositivo final.
Correcto.
Puerta de enlace.
Incorrecto.
¿Cuáles son los dos tipos principales de dispositivos Thread?
Dispositivo Thread mínimo (MTD).
Correcto.
Dispositivo de conversación completa (FTD).
Correcto.
Dispositivo de subproceso en miniatura (MTD).
Incorrecto.
Dispositivo final somnolencia (SED).
Incorrecto.
¿Cuál de las siguientes afirmaciones sobre los routers no es verdadera?
Un router puede inhabilitar su transceptor para reducir la energía.
Los dispositivos que funcionan como routers no inhabilitan su transceptor. (De ser así, no podrían funcionar correctamente como router).
Un router reenvía paquetes para dispositivos de red.
Esta afirmación es verdadera.
El router mantiene habilitado el transmisor en todo momento.
Esta afirmación es verdadera. Para funcionar correctamente como router, un dispositivo debe mantener su transceptor en línea en todo momento.
Un router proporciona servicios de asignación seguros para los dispositivos que intentan conectarse a la red.
Esta afirmación es verdadera. La asignación de comandos es una función importante de un router de subprocesos.
¿Cuándo puede un dispositivo actualizarse a un router?
Cuando es un REED y es el único nodo al alcance de un nuevo dispositivo final que desea unirse a la red de Thread.
Exacto. En estas circunstancias, un REED puede ascender a un router.
Cuando es un dispositivo final que intenta unirse a la red Thread
Incorrecto.
Cuando es un REED y la red Thread se fusionó con una red más grande.
Incorrecto.
¿Cuándo puede un router dejar de funcionar como un router?
Cuando no tiene hijos.
Correcto. Si un router no tiene elementos secundarios, puede volver a usar un Dispositivo Final por su cuenta.
Cuando un nuevo dispositivo final intenta unirse a la red de Thread
No. En este caso, un router no puede volver a un dispositivo final.
Cuando otro dispositivo de la red opta por convertirse en un router.
Esto podría ser cierto. Si la cantidad de routers de Thread aumenta a 24 o más, los routers de Thread existentes pueden comenzar a evaluar si se convertirán en dispositivos finales.
Considera una situación en la que una red Thread contiene dos grupos de nodos que tienen conectividad de radio dentro del grupo, pero no con miembros del otro. ¿Qué conclusión se puede obtener de esto?
Hay más de una partición en esa red.
Correcto. Se crea una partición en torno a cada grupo de nodos que puede comunicarse entre sí. Cuando hay varios grupos de nodos que pueden comunicarse entre sí, pero no con miembros de otros grupos, se puede deducir que estos grupos constituyen una partición distinta.
La red perdió a su líder.
Incorrecto.
Se desconectaron todos los routers de la red.
Incorrecto. En ese caso, ninguno de los nodos podría comunicarse entre sí.
¿Qué dispositivo se usa para conectar Thread con redes que no son de Thread?
Una puerta de enlace.
Si bien en las redes tradicionales, el término "puerta de enlace" hace referencia a un dispositivo que conecta dos redes, existe un término más específico en el contexto de una red Thread.
Un router de borde.
Correcto. Se usa un router de borde para conectar Thread con redes que no son de Thread.
Un firewall.
La respuesta no es correcta.
Un puente.
Incorrecto. Este término se refiere a un concepto similar en las redes tradicionales: un dispositivo que conecta dos LAN que usan el *mismo* protocolo de red.
¿Cuántos líderes puede tener una partición de red Thread?
Puede no ser ninguna, o bien ninguna.
Es incorrecto. Una partición de red de Thread no puede tener menos de un líder.
Uno y solo uno.
Correcto. Una partición de red de Thread puede tener un solo líder.
Más de una.
No. Una partición de red de Thread no puede tener varios líderes.